import random
import string
from builtins import str
import mock
import unittest
class JsonRpcClientTestBase(unittest.TestCase):
"""Base class for tests of JSONRPC clients.
Contains infrastructure for mocking responses.
"""
MOCK_RESP = (
b'{"id": 0, "result": 123, "error": null, "status": 1, "uid": 1, '
b'"callback": null}')
MOCK_RESP_WITHOUT_CALLBACK = (
b'{"id": 0, "result": 123, "error": null, "status": 1, "uid": 1}')
MOCK_RESP_TEMPLATE = (
'{"id": %d, "result": 123, "error": null, "status": 1, "uid": 1, '
'"callback": null}')
MOCK_RESP_UNKNOWN_STATUS = (
b'{"id": 0, "result": 123, "error": null, "status": 0, '
b'"callback": null}')
MOCK_RESP_WITH_CALLBACK = (
b'{"id": 0, "result": 123, "error": null, "status": 1, "uid": 1, '
b'"callback": "1-0"}')
MOCK_RESP_WITH_ERROR = b'{"id": 0, "error": 1, "status": 1, "uid": 1}'
MOCK_RESP_FLEXIABLE_RESULT_LENGTH = (
'{"id": 0, "result": "%s", "error": null, "status": 0, "callback": null}')
class MockSocketFile:
def __init__(self, resp):
self.resp = resp
self.last_write = None
def write(self, msg):
self.last_write = msg
def readline(self):
return self.resp
def flush(self):
pass
def setup_mock_socket_file(self, mock_create_connection, resp=MOCK_RESP):
"""Sets up a fake socket file from the mock connection.
Args:
mock_create_connection: The mock method for creating a method.
resp: (str) response to give. MOCK_RESP by default.
Returns:
The mock file that will be injected into the code.
"""
fake_file = self.MockSocketFile(resp)
fake_conn = mock.MagicMock()
fake_conn.makefile.return_value = fake_file
mock_create_connection.return_value = fake_conn
return fake_file
def generate_rpc_response(self, response_length=1024):
length = response_length - len(self.MOCK_RESP_FLEXIABLE_RESULT_LENGTH) + 2
chars = string.ascii_letters + string.digits
random_msg = ''.join(random.choice(chars) for i in range(length))
mock_response = self.MOCK_RESP_FLEXIABLE_RESULT_LENGTH % random_msg
return bytes(mock_response, 'utf-8')
